description Computer Vision is a field where vision sensors capture physical world information,which are then processed by computers to obtain the knowledge of the physical world. Vision sensors vary from ultrasonic sensors to cameras, while the knowledge of the physical world ranges from object detection & recognition to motion tracking. There are several processing techniques employed in Computer Vision, such as CNN and Image Processing. To date, CNN is the most popular technique used and this make CNN hardware implementation of interest. This report discusses the implementation of CNN methods in FPGA.
